Exam preparation tips
 
Revision: Vacation
Organise your notes
Choose topics to revise further and do additional reading – follow up
on seminar and lecture bibliographies
Look at past papers: 
Make lists
Ensure you have plenty of primary evidence which you can deploy in
a range of contexts
Focus especially on key texts or monuments you have analysed in
lectures and seminars, and think about the questions you have been
asked to consider.

Term 3
Engage with revision sessions or materials on the Moodle
Get ahead  - if there’s something specific you’d like to revise, ask your
lecturer in advance.
Work with others to brain storm particular questions from past
papers.
